If this was a beauty pageant, ferrari would win hands down. But unfortunately, ferraris have had an otrocious history when it comes to reliability and self-destructing while parked. The nissan is another great attempt but falls short on the reliability curve, especially when launch control is used frequently. Nissan engineers will get it right, maybe with the vspec. The ZR1 is the true all around "supercar". Yeah its got plastic bits, and the interior is not so great, but what a performer. The gt2, what else can I say, its the gold standard for "relatively" affordable supercars. Its reliable, fast and exotic enough that you'll rarely see 4 different ones in the same day. Bottom line tho, is that each are "tools", all race cars in disguise. I'm just glad that there are varying cars at different budgets that can do the job right! For me, it'll be the ZR1.
